Chef Yves Gras prepares each day –on board- a menu inspired by French gastronomy, combining tradition and creativeness.
Starters

Pan-fried Burgundy snail and spinach fritters with basil and port
Mediterranean prawn parcel with tomato compote and reduced balsamic vinegar
Duck foie gras, roast peach chutney and raisin bread
Thick-cut smoked salmon with Southern spices, potato mousse and caraway vinaigrette
Creamed sweetcorn cappuccino, smoked bacon chunks and salted popcorn
Main dishes
 Pan-fried duck breast, light dried fruit polenta and caramelized spices
Arctic char with lime, eggplant crumble
Thick-cut roast lamb, crunchy potato and cepe mushroom parmentier, baby onion gravy
Leek roll, pan-fried scallops and fennel cream
Pan-fried five-peppered beef, courgettes fried in olive oil and carrot compote
Fillet pf pork with black olives, gravy, served with potato and hazelnut gratin
Vegetable medley and parmesan tuile
Desserts

Chocolate melt filled with a raspberry coulis, pan fried red fruit tuile
Dacquoise biscuit with pineapple, peppermint coulis
Religieuse pastry with Nutella®, an old childhood favorite
Pastry strip with figs and almond cream
Apple cooked in butter, iced Isigny cream flavored with Calvados
